About the Item

An elegant 19th-century Oriental desk box or storage chest, crafted from wood and hand-decorated with exquisite polychrome detailing in shades of red, black, gold, and green. It features rich geometric ornamentation inspired by Indian artisanal traditions, with painted details that retain an attractive patina developed over time. The hinged lid, secured by an original wrought-iron latch, opens to reveal an interior with three drawers—one larger upper drawer and two lower ones—ideal for organizing documents, jewelry, writing implements, or small valuables. An iron handle at the top makes it easy to carry, while the locking mechanism retains its original character. A decorative yet functional piece representing traditional Oriental craftsmanship, perfect for Mediterranean, colonial, bohemian, or eclectic interiors.

This large antique paper mâché and lacquered box is unsigned, but presumed to have been made in England in circa 1870 in the period Aesthetic Movement style. The box was made as a sewing chest, but could be adapted for other purposes such as a jewelry box. The box is composed of paper mâché with a glossy black lacquered finish. The stepped top has scalloped edges and a detailed border of inlaid mother of pearl done with a floral motif. The central portion of the box's top is done with large pieces of mother of pearl or abalone shell and accented with flaked gilt details. The front and sides of the box are accented with hand-painted gilt detailing and the inside of the top is hand painted with floral accents. The inner tray of this box is divided into several compartments, some having fabric covered lids with molded handles. The inside of the box is paper lined in the same blue patterned paper as the tray. There is small brass lock on the front of the box, but there is no key.
